要解决AWS数据管道无法验证S3访问权限的问题,您可以尝试以下方法:
示例代码:
{
"Version": "2012-10-17",
"Statement": [
{
"Sid": "AllowDataPipelineAccess",
"Effect": "Allow",
"Principal": {
"Service": "datapipeline.amazonaws.com"
},
"Action": [
"s3:GetObject",
"s3:PutObject",
"s3:ListBucket"
],
"Resource": [
"arn:aws:s3:::your-bucket-name/*",
"arn:aws:s3:::your-bucket-name"
]
}
]
}
请将your-bucket-name
替换为您的S3存储桶名称。
检查AWS数据管道角色权限:确保您的AWS数据管道角色具有足够的权限来访问S3存储桶。您可以通过以下步骤检查和更新角色权限:
检查AWS数据管道配置:确保您的AWS数据管道配置中正确设置了S3存储桶名称和区域。您可以通过以下步骤检查和更新配置:
检查AWS数据管道日志:查看AWS数据管道日志以获取更多详细信息。您可以在AWS数据管道控制台的“管道”菜单中选择“日志”来查看日志记录。检查日志以了解更多有关访问权限和错误的信息。
通过检查和更新S3访问权限、AWS数据管道角色权限、配置和日志,您应该能够解决AWS数据管道无法验证S3访问权限的问题。